1. Make (Formerly Integromat)

Formerly known as Integromat, Make stands out as an all-in-one solution for automation. Much like Zapier, this platform is designed to connect various apps and automate workflows. Yet, it has a few distinct advantages that set it apart.

Make’s visual builder allows users to create and visualize intricate automation scenarios easily. While the platform supports straightforward processes, it will enable you to branch out your workflows for more complex business needs.

Make supports over 1,000 apps and has nearly 6,000 automated workflows to help you get started. You can also play with data as it moves between apps. This ensures users create a customized fit for each task. 

What makes ‘Make’ a good Zapier alternative includes the following:

  • Supports complex workflows and automation.
  • Offers a more cost-effective plan without limits in flow creation and automated tasks.
  • Provides users with error-handling routines for smoother and more reliable automation.
  • Gives users a higher degree of customization, flexibility and control.

2. IFTTT

IFTTT (If This Then That) is one of the most well-known automation platforms. Since its first release in 2011, IFTTT has become one of the oldest but still useful and relevant business automation tools.

IFTTT provides businesses with a user-friendly way to integrate different services and automate tasks. Its main functionality involves applets, a combination of triggers (this) and actions (that). These applets allow businesses to connect two services so that if a specified event happens in one service, a certain action is automatically executed in another. 

IFTTT supports many apps and services. Yet, what makes IFTTT unique is that it integrates with a wide variety of non-business services, like IoT devices and consumer apps. This ensures businesses from various sectors always find the most relevant integrations.

What makes IFTTT a good Zapier alternative is the following advantages:

  • IFTTT’s straightforward “if this, then that.” It is one of the most user-friendly automation platforms available.
  • Offers a free tier, making it accessible for small businesses.
  • Has numerous ready-made applets, making it easy for users to get started.

3. Automate.io

Automate.io provides great value for businesses aiming to streamline their processes and make task automation easier. It connects with over 200 cloud apps, making it seamless for companies to connect to their favorite platforms. Many automation platforms also focus on single-trigger, single-action workflows. However, Automate.io offers multi-step workflows. This means companies can create more complex automations that involve several actions based on a single trigger.

Automate.io also makes it easy for new users to get set up. It provides ready-to-use templates that businesses commonly use. In turn, this speeds up your automation process while also adhering to industry best practices. 

Additionally, this automation tool has a simple drag-and-drop interface. While Zapier’s platform is also user-friendly, Automate.io’s interface may be more intuitive for those just starting with automation.

What makes Automate.io a better alternative to Zapier includes the following advantages:

  • Simple drag-and-drop workflow creator with team collaboration abilities.
  • Offers more competitive pricing plans than Zapier, giving you more bang for your buck.
  • Provides dedicated and swift customer support.

4. Microsoft Power Automate

Similar to IFTTT, Microsoft Power Automate is a powerful automation tool you can make your go-to. Microsoft Power Automate seamlessly integrates with Microsoft’s other apps. Therefore, if you use tools like Outlook, Teams, Excel and SharePoint, you can merge the entire suite of 

Microsoft tools with Power Automate. However, Power Automate connects with more apps outside of Microsoft’s suite. You can automate hundreds of tasks with connected apps like WebMerge to create documents. You can even send files to the cloud with software like Box or invoices with Freshbooks.

Power Automate functions on three pillars — business process automation, robotic process automation and digital process automation. On top of this, it provides Microsoft’s AI Builder with suggestions on the processes you may automate and how. 

Microsoft Power Automate is a good Zapier alternative because of the following advantages:

  • AI-powered automation process builder for workflow creation assistance.
  • More affordable solution to Zapier with subscription and pay-as-you-go plans.
  • Built-in process advisor to discover bottlenecks and create smoother workflows.

5. Workato

Workato has quickly risen as one of the top integration and automation platforms. It distinguishes itself from the likes of Zapier, with a keen focus on enterprise-level solutions. With its blend of simplicity and power, Workato provides businesses with a robust tool. It helps automate complex workflows and integrate an entire suite of apps. 

Some connected services you can expect to work with seamlessly include Asana, Dropbox and NetSuite. Yet, Workato supports over 1,000 apps — from CRM and collaboration to e-commerce solutions. Therefore, enterprises can integrate their entire tech stack with ease. 

Workato uses a “recipe” approach to automation. This is where businesses can build workflows using a combination of triggers, conditions and actions. Thus, your recipes can be as simple or as complex as needed. 

You may choose Workato over Zapier for the following reasons:

  • Offers advanced automation and integration with the power of AI. 
  • Integrates with on-premise systems and cloud solutions.
  • Allows businesses to automate tasks across multiple channels, including mobile, messaging platforms and more.
  • Provides sophisticated error-handling and resolution features, addressing disruptions promptly.

6. Integrately

Integrately is one of the largest automation tools focusing on user experience and simplicity. With its promise of setting up automation in just a click, Integrately makes a hassle-free alternative to Zapier. Its one-click automation features instantly lets users choose from thousands of ready-made workflows. That way, you save the time and effort traditionally required to set up automation.

Integrately also offers a continuously growing list of supported apps. These platforms span across CRM, marketing, e-commerce and more. Therefore, you get a wide range of tools at your disposal. 

It has an easy-to-use dashboard, making it beginner-friendly for those new to automation. You can also create custom workflows so you have solutions that address your business’s specific needs.

Integrately makes a good Zapier alternative due to the following reasons:

  • Speedy and simple one-click automation.
  • No hidden costs, making it easier for businesses to budget and plan.
  • Takes user feedback into account for new features and integrations.
  • Responsive and helpful customer support.
